## Deployment: Rate Limiting

The Kestrelgate internal API gateway enforces per-client rate limits at the edge tier. Limits are applied by client token, not by IP, so support tickets about throttling should always include the token name. When a client exceeds its bucket, the gateway returns a 429 with a retry-after header. Limits are tuned per environment and reloaded without a restart. Before escalating a throttling complaint, verify the active settings shown below.

service settings:
[casax]
port = 6379
team = rusir
host = casax.zemvarhq.corp
region = outer-4
access_code = ac_9808ce
timeout_ms = 1500

Hey new assistants! During fire drills at Quillbrook House, everyone musters on the south lawn by the flagpole. Your job is grabbing the roll-call tablet from the reception cupboard and ticking off your team. The cupboard stays locked, so you'll want the access code handy — here it is:

door code, tahag-bajof: bdg-XFGRYD-19304280

- [ ] Wellness room orientation (Night Shift)

Show the new starter Wellness Room 4 on the Halloway Wing. Bookings run through the Restful portal; night shift gets priority between 02:00 and 05:00. Lights are motion-timed, so warn them it goes dark after 20 minutes still. The door stays locked overnight. Enter the pass code below on the keypad to open it.

door code, kawip-bagap: bdg-HQEWH-4

## Configuration

Digest scheduling for Mailgrove is all env-driven, so no code changes needed. Set `DIGEST_CRON` (we default to 6am), `DIGEST_BATCH_SIZE`, and `DIGEST_TZ` in your `.env`. Keep batch size under 2000 or the worker gets cranky. One last thing: the sender credential for the relay goes on the line right after this one.

env line for fafof-fahag: LEDGER_TOKEN5=f8790